Mahatma Gandhi
18.06.2007 India’s ‘Father of the Nation’, Mahatma Gandhi, has influenced many movements for freedom and civil rights across the world and inspired leaders like Nelson Mandela and Martin Luther King Jr. His birth anniversary will now be observed each year as the International Day of Non-Violence. The UN hopes Gandhi’s unique means of non-violent action will promote “a culture of peace, tolerance, understanding and non-violence.”

Violation of civil rights by displacement in Sri Lanka
08.06.2007 Hong Kong based Human rights organisation AHRC wants a high level inquiry into the forcible removal of several hundred Tamils from Sri Lankan capital Colombo and seek further action for their protection.
